Letters to the editor
AN AUTOR’S PODCAST
‘Letters to the editor’ is the podcast for those who enjoy intelligent humor and the ironic observation of everyday life.
Through his letters, Enrique transforms daily anecdotes into sharp reflections on modern society, achieving a blend of warmth and depth that resonates with the audience.
It’s a space to laugh, think, and discover an endless source of inspiration and lighthearted critique in the ordinary.


‘Letters to the editor’ is an author-driven podcast created and hosted by Enrique Stuyck Roma, a renowned journalist, lawyer, and businessman from Madrid. Throughout his career, Enrique has stood out for his ability to translate ideas into words, earning a Guinness World Record with over 10,000 published Letters to the Editor.
In this new project, Enrique takes a fresh and relaxed approach to exploring and reflecting on life through captivating anecdotes, many of them shared by the very people who experienced them. With a timeless and engaging format, ‘Letters to the editor’ invites the audience to discover new perspectives in every episode.
